Tutoriales
Hace unos días vimos cómo crear un buscador interno con Google Custom Search Engine, herramienta recomendada por dos motivos:
- Conocer los intereses de nuestros visitantes, y
- Ahorrar recursos del servidor.
Pero, si lo que uno busca es conocer a fondo todas las búsquedas que se realizan en nuestro sitio web, la mejor opción es almacenar los datos en nuestra propia BD y luego reaizar análisis a nuestro gusto.

Los datos que proporciona Google Coop son demasiado estrechos. Coop sólo muestran un listado con las principales búsquedas, más no toda la información al detalle. Sin embargo, si nosotros decidimos almacenar los datos de las búsquedas, estaremos utilizaremos muchos más recursos, pero a su vez, nos beneficiaremos con mejores análisis.
Ahora vamos a crear nuestro ranking de búsquedas con PHP y MySQL, similar a lo que es Google Zeitgeist, para nuestro sitio (script incluido)...
¿La computadora esta lenta? ¿Tienes que esperar varias pausas para que la PC se apague? Vía Daily Cup of Tech, encuentro un video tutorial que nos muestra unos cuantos tips para acelerar la PC.
Como vemos, los tips son realizando cambios en los registros de Windows, en el que si algún proceso se queda colgado, Windows los termine con mayor rapidez (no espere tanto). Es por ello, que se reducen los dígitos. Ahora, los valores no se pueden rebajar tanto, como para que Windows no permita o deje el tiempo suficiente para que los procesos trabajen.
Si el video les deja dudas, es mejor no tocar los registros. Caso contrario, hay que hacerlo con precaución. Por ejemplo, algo útil es hacer un backup de los registros. Para ello hay que entrar en Inicio -> Ejecutar -> Escribir regedit -> Pulsar Enter -> Menú Archivo -> importar/exportar. Y así trabajamos más seguros. :)
Con las mejoras del MSN Messenger, el mensajero que viene por defecto en Windows XP queda, cómo el periódico de ayer, en el olvido. Y esto es lógico, las herramientas y diseño prolijo de las últimas versiones del mensajero son muy llamativos, por decir lo menos. Es por ello que con este sencillo truco, veremos cómo desinstalar el Windows Messenger completamente.
Lo único que se debe hacer es:
- Ir al menú Inicio -> Ejecutar
- Escribir RunDll32 advpack.dll,LaunchINFSection %windir%\INF\msmsgs.inf,BLC.Remove
- Pulsar Aceptar, tal y cómo se ve en la siguiente imagen.

Y listo, hemos desinstalado por completo el mensajero.
Hace unos días se ha lanzado un servicio web muy interesante para evitar hacer hotlinking (mostrar imágenes alojadas en web ajenas). La forma de aplicarlo es muy sencilla, y aunque he visto que el sistema tiene algunos fallos, la herramienta es nueva, veo que ya lo han corregido.
ImgRed es un servicio web que te permite hacer hotlinking sin robarle el ancho de banda a otro sitio web (Redirecciona las imágenes). ¿Cómo utilizar ImgRed? Muy simple. Basta con añadir la url de imgred antes de la url de la imagen a mostrar. Por ejemplo:
<img src="http://imgred.com/http://www.mozilla.com/img/firefox/main-feature2.jpg" />
Además, el sistema también nos permite mostrar thumbnails, el path para estos sería:
<img src="http://imgred.com/tn/http://www.mozilla.com/img/firefox/main-feature2.jpg" />
Sin embargo, aún no lo recomiendo, pues he visto que muchas veces no muestra la imagen correctamente. Espero que pronto lo solucionen.
Ahora bien, ya hemos visto que a la hora de publicar podemos evitar el hotlink simplemente añadiendo http://imgred.com/ a nuestros artículos. Sin embargo, quien nos asegura que el servicio funcione correctamente por mucho tiempo.
Se imaginan que después de 6 meses publicando artículos, el sitio caiga ó lo vuelvan Premium. ¿Qué haríamos? ¿Cambiar las urls? Una buena alternativa, es utilizar una pequeña función PHP que he creado para utilizar ImgRed automáticamente...
En Jaslabs han publicado un interesante listado de consejos y tips para optimizar las consultas MySQL. Aquí las traducimos y ampliamos.
1. Usar el comando Explain
El comando Explain explica como se lleva a cabo una consulta SELECT, como se usan los índices y como se unen las tablas. La forma de utilizarlo es la siguiente:
Explain select * from tabla
Ahora, en lugar de ejecutar la consulta, se mostrará un listado con la información ya mencionada anteriormente. Esto es muy útil para optimizar las consultas. Más información.
2. Usar permisos poco complejos
Por defecto, el usuario que utilizamos para conectar nuestra aplicación a la Base de datos, goza todos los permisos MySQL. Sin embargo, el utilizar un usuario con sólo los permisos necesarios (para la publicación, por ejemplo), permiten a MySQL reducir la comprobación de cada uno de los permisos, cada vez que el cliente MySQL ejecute las sentencias (INSERT, por ejemplo) ...

En el elogodesign.com han compilado alrededor de 300 enlaces a recursos que pueden ayudarnos a elaborar nuestro propio logo. Desde ¿Por qué es necesario elaborar un buen logo? ¿Qué programas utilizar y por qué? ¿Cómo utilizar los programas? ¿Qué formatos son los más utilizados? ¿Cómo escoger los colores? ¿Qué tipos de fuentes utilizar? ¿Dónde encontrar inspiración?, algunos tips de diseñadores de logos y más. En general, es una muy buena compilación de recursos, con el único pero, de estar todo en ingles.
Enlace | Complete Logo Design Guide
- « primera
- ‹ anterior
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- …
- siguiente ›
- última »




